Solid lens. This would be my preference. From best to worst:

17-55 2.8 IS
15-85
17-85
18-55 IS
28-135 IS

But for $100 you really can't beat the 18-55 IS. Great sharpness and very useful. If you want to spend 3x as much, get the 17-85.
